Many fitness subscription services offer a “take a quiz” type of assessment to help them understand your style, activity level, and size. Then, they will send you a monthly shipment of activewear that should be a perfect fit. The best ones also take the time to review the feedback they receive from their customers to continuously refine their offering and better serve their members.

Some fitness subscriptions will provide you with full outfits (think leggings, a tank top, and a pair of sneakers) while others focus more on individual pieces. Regardless of your preferences, you should always select a service that takes the quality and durability of their clothing seriously. They should be able to back their claims with proof of test washing and material testing, or at the very least, provide a link to those results.

Another important consideration when selecting a fitness subscription service is the company’s policies on returns and exchanges. Look for a company that offers flexible returns within 90 days of purchase if you don’t like what you receive or they haven’t met your expectations. Some companies, like Fabletics, even let you return the clothes to their Happy Return Bars at over 70 locations nationwide or print a prepaid shipping label to ship them back to the warehouse for free.
